DANN, Thomas Ralph [SRGP 91293] – Largo – Thomas Ralph Dann, whose Tom’s Barber Shop on East Bay Drive marked its 25th anniversary June 1, died Monday [Sept. 2, 1985]. He was 61 and lived at 15695 Bedford Circle E., Largo, FL. Mr. Dann opened his shop at 3151 East Bay Drive, just west of Fulton Drive, in 1960 when Largo’s population was 5,302. "I liked this area because it was so quiet and remote," he told a Times reporter in May. Largo’s population is now nearly 63,000, and Mr. Dann said he and his wife, Donna, were considering a move to the Blanton area of Pasco County. But any move would have had to wait until his daughter, Laurie, finished her senior year at Pinellas Park High School, where she is an outstanding diver. She recently won four gold medals, a silver and a bronze at the Sunshine State Games. Mr. Dann was born in Mansfield, PA, and moved here in 1959 from Elmira, NY, where he had been a barber for 11 years. He was a member of Star Lodge 778 F&AM, Largo, and American Legion Turner-Brandon Post 7, Clearwater. He was a World War II Army veteran. Survivors besides his wife and daughter Laurie include another daughter Jarilyn Waits, Tarpon Springs; a son Thomas E., San Antonio; his mother Hildred Dann, Clearwater; three sisters, Ruth Carlson, Clearwater, Marie Cunningham, Mansfield, and Arlene Kingsley, Millerton, PA, and two grandchildren. The National Cremation Society of Clearwater handled arrangements. – Tampa Bay Times, St. Petersburg, FL, 4 September 1985, Wednesday, p.72 |
